Hello Luis,
On 12/07/2022 09:59:08+0200, Luis Enriquez wrote:
> This allows choosing padding algorithm when building fitImage. It may be pkcs-1.5 or pss.
>
> Signed-off-by: LUIS ENRIQUEZ <luis.enriquez@se.com>
This has to match the From: header. The solution is the either send that
from your se.com address or add an in-body From:
